Employing the relationship between the black-hole thermodynamic functions and the Euclidean path-integral approach to quantum gravity, the author proves, in the framework of four-dimensional Einstein gravity, that the entropy of a stationary black-hole with a bifurcating Killing horizon surrounded by arbitrary classical matter fields is one quarter of the area of the event horizon independent of the matter fields involved.
